"Error registering Charge 3 with Fitbit wallet HTTP 500" message

Replies are disabled for this topic. Start a new one or visit our Help Center.

Hello there,

 

I got my Charge 3 yesterday and everything works smoothly, with the single exception of FitBit Pay, which I cannot set up.

 

When I try to register my device I click Wallet and "Get started" but eventually I see "Checking for PIN..." then after a long wait: "Error registering charge 3 with Fitbit wallet HTTP 500". The firmware version is 28.20001.49.45, the model is FB410.

 

This seems to be the same exact issue referred here: https://community.fitbit.com/t5/Charge-3/Error-registering-charge-3-with-Fitbit-wallet/m-p/3092223 (only the accepted solution of un-pairing all other Bluetooth devices does not work for me, and neither do other solutions proposed by other forum members (i.e. not using the WiFi, uninstalling & reinstalling the app).

Hello everyone, thanks for your participation in the Community.

I am sorry for the delay in respond and appreciate all the efforts in trying to fix this "Error registering Charge 3 with Fitbit wallet HTTP 500" message by yourselves.

@lauramcastro@Jazzi1@awanderer7, @SunsetRunner, @eevonhon and @calvaris. In Apr 9th we received some information about an issue like this, that was fixed on Apr 11th. You should be able to setup Fitbit Pay if you haven't already.

You just need to follow the instructions provided in the help article How do I set up Fitbit Pay?. If you keep experiencing this problem, feel free to provide me with some screenshots of the error.

You should try use other supported devices to setup fitbit wallet. 

I tried to reboot and reinstall app on both device, my phone and fitbit charge 3. But it never work. However, when i disconnected charge 3 from my fitbit account and reconnect it by using ipad air. Then i setup fitbit wallet. It worked for me and i hope it work for u.
